Everywhere
Goodwill Student Discounts
Still have that goofy student ID with you? Let the good people of Goodwill take pity on your loans; they'll grant you a 10% off student discount. (And, what's better than a grant without interest?) Monday through Friday every week, Goodwill stores in New York offer a 10% discount to anyone with a student ID, and Chicago Goodwill stores offer student shoppers 10% off every Saturday. That 10% off comes in especially handy if you're shopping Goodwill's "boutique" items!
